Nestled alongside the Tennessee-Tombigbee Waterway, Columbus is the hometown of the legendary playwright Tennessee Williams. Anchored in a rich history, Columbus touts a bevy of grand antebellum homes and a vibrant historic downtown. The Mississippi University for Women, the country’s first public college for women, is also located in Columbus.
Known as “the City that has it all,” Columbus offers residents access to an array of community festivals and events throughout the year in addition to numerous top-notch restaurants, specialty shops, and exceptional recreational opportunities at Columbus Propst Park, Lee Park, Lion Hills Center and Golf Club, and the Tennessee-Tombigbee Waterway. Convenience to the Columbus Air Force Base and U.S. 45 affords many residents easy commutes.
